The Ford Transit does not include a factory front tow point to safely recover the van from. The Van Compass front tow point bolts to the frame and protrudes through the front plastic bumper cover. An aluminum cover plate is included for a clean, finished look. Designed to utilize a 3/4" D-ring to secure a tow rope or winch line to the vehicle, this tow point can be installed on the driver or passenger side of the van. (Sold individually for one side of the vehicle, 2 required to do both sides of a vehicle)
Features
- 3/4" Steel - Front Hook
- 1/4" Steel - Mounting plate and gussets
- 3/16" Steel - Bumper connection brackets
- Aluminum cut cover plate
- Mounting hardware included
- Black textured powder coating

FITMENT GUIDE
MODEL: TRANSIT
YEAR: 2015-PRESENT
DRIVE TYPE: AWD and RWD
NOTE: Not compatible with Van Compass receiver hitch mount or hidden winch mount.
NOTE: Sold individually, not side specific. Quantity 2 needed to do both sides of a vehicle.
LABOR TIMES
Recommended Shop Labor Time: 3 Hours

I just put this point point on my 2015 Transit and I was thoroughly impressed with the directions for install. Easy to follow and accurate, making the job enjoyable. The only additions I have for the directions are: 1) a long socket extension (8") is mandatory and not merely recommended for removing the bumper post, 2) you will need a die grinder or a good Dremel tool with a grinder post to grind through the spot welds (a angle grinder or grinder wheel are too wide to fit into the space), and 3) a deep socket set makes the installation of the hook easier, because you will not need to lie under the van and use the long socket extension.
